What if you roll doubles in monopoly




















In order to make a move, two dice are rolled by the player. If the dice show the same number on each, it is called Doubles. However, if a player rolls Doubles three times in succession in one turn , they immediately move to Jail without moving the third time. In the game of Monopoly, a pair of dice are rolled to move a player's piece around the board. If a double is rolled the dice show the same number , the player receives another roll of the dice.
